What is Lottery Gambling?

At its core, lottery gambling involves the selection of numbers, typically through the purchase of a ticket, with the hope that those numbers will match the numbers drawn in a lottery event. This form of gambling is often regulated by governments, which use the proceeds for public services or education. Players can choose from a series of traditional games like Mega Millions or state lotteries, as well as newer forms that rely on technology and online platforms.

The Different Types of Lottery Games

Lottery games vary significantly, and understanding the differences can help players make informed choices. Here are some common types:

  • Draw Games: In these games, players select a set of numbers that are then drawn at a specific time. Games like Powerball and state lotteries fall under this category.
  • Instant Win Games: Also known as scratch-offs, these games allow players to win prizes instantly by revealing symbols or numbers on their tickets.
  • Raffles: Players purchase tickets for a chance to win a prize drawn from a pool, often with limited tickets available, increasing the chances of winning.
  • Online Lotteries: These games can be played through websites and apps, often offering unique formats, such as live draws or interactive games.

Lottery Odds and Payout Structures

Understanding the odds of winning a lottery is crucial for players. Each game has its own odds based on the number of possible combinations of numbers. Lottery odds are often expressed in terms of how likely it is to win a specific prize, with large jackpots often having the lowest odds. It’s important to remember that while lottery winnings can be life-changing, the majority of players will not win big prizes. Payout structures can also vary; some lotteries have fixed prizes, while others have jackpots that roll over if not won.

Game Selection: Quick Picks vs. Personal Numbers

In lottery play, players can choose to use Quick Picks—where the system randomly generates numbers—or select their own numbers based on personal significance. Research has shown that Quick Picks are statistically as likely to win as personal numbers; however, players often find personal numbers more engaging and meaningful. A strategy incorporating both methods can keep the game exciting.

Setting Limits for Your Gambling Activities

Establish financial and time limits before you begin playing. Decide on a weekly or monthly budget for gambling that does not negatively impact your financial responsibilities. Adhering to these limits can help you enjoy the game responsibly.

Recognizing Problem Gambling Warning Signs

Acknowledge the signs of problematic behavior. If you find yourself chasing losses, feeling anxious about gambling, or spending more money than intended, it’s crucial to reevaluate your playing habits. Understanding these signs is the first step towards addressing any potential issues.

Resources for Responsible Gambling

Utilize available resources for responsible gambling support. Many countries have hotlines, websites, and counseling services to assist those who may be struggling with gambling addiction. Engage with these resources if you feel your gambling habits are becoming problematic.
